Living a Life of Purpose: Discovering God's Unique Plan for You ππ
In this fast-paced world, many of us often find ourselves searching for meaning and purpose. We strive to find our place, to uncover God's unique plan for our lives. As Christians, we are blessed with the guidance of the Bible, which provides us with numerous examples and teachings on how to live a life of purpose. Let us dive into the scriptures to discover the wonders of living with a divine purpose in mind.
1οΈβ£ Look to the story of Moses, who was chosen by God to deliver the Israelites from slavery in Egypt. Despite his initial doubts and insecurities, Moses trusted in God's plan and fulfilled his purpose.
2οΈβ£ "For I know the plans I have for you," declares the Lord, "plans to prosper you and not to harm you, plans to give you hope and a future." (Jeremiah 29:11) This verse reminds us that God has a unique plan for each of our lives, a plan that is filled with hope and blessings.
3οΈβ£ Jesus, our ultimate example, lived a life of purpose. His teachings and actions emphasized love, compassion, and forgiveness. We should strive to emulate His character in our own lives.
4οΈβ£ "But seek first his kingdom and his righteousness, and all these things will be given to you as well." (Matthew 6:33) This verse reminds us to prioritize God's kingdom and righteousness above all else. By doing so, we will find fulfillment and blessings beyond measure.
5οΈβ£ Just as Jesus called His disciples to follow Him, He calls us to do the same. We are each given unique gifts and talents, and when we use them for God's glory, we fulfill our purpose.
6οΈβ£ "Trust in the Lord with all your heart and lean not on your own understanding; in all your ways submit to him, and he will make your paths straight." (Proverbs 3:5-6) This scripture encourages us to trust in God and surrender our plans to Him. By doing so, He will direct our paths and lead us to our purpose.
7οΈβ£ The Apostle Paul serves as another powerful example. Initially a persecutor of Christians, he had a radical encounter with Jesus on the road to Damascus. From that moment on, Paul dedicated his life to sharing the Gospel and planting churches.
8οΈβ£ "For we are God's handiwork, created in Christ Jesus to do good works, which God prepared in advance for us to do." (Ephesians 2:10) This verse reminds us that we are uniquely created by God and have a purpose in His grand plan. Our good works are a reflection of His love.
9οΈβ£ Prayer is essential in discovering and aligning ourselves with God's purpose. By seeking His guidance and wisdom, we open ourselves to His divine direction.
π "Do not conform to the pattern of this world, but be transformed by the renewing of your mind." (Romans 12:2) This scripture reminds us to live counter-culturally, focusing on God's ways rather than the world's. It is through this transformation that we can live a purposeful life.
1οΈβ£1οΈβ£ As Christians, we are called to love God with all our hearts, souls, and minds. By prioritizing our relationship with Him, we will naturally align ourselves with His purpose for our lives.
1οΈβ£2οΈβ£ "A new command I give you: Love one another. As I have loved you, so you must love one another." (John 13:34) Jesus' command to love one another is not only a way of life but also a part of our purpose as Christians. By loving others, we reflect God's love and bring light to the world.
1οΈβ£3οΈβ£ Trusting in God's timing is crucial. We may not always understand why things happen as they do, but we can trust that God's plans are perfect and that He is working all things for our good.
1οΈβ£4οΈβ£ "Delight yourself in the Lord, and he will give you the desires of your heart." (Psalm 37:4) When we align our desires with God's will, He will grant them to us. Our purpose and desires become intertwined with His plan.
1οΈβ£5οΈβ£ Finally, let us remember that living a life of purpose is not about our own achievements or recognition, but about bringing glory to God. When we live according to His purpose, we experience true joy and fulfillment.
